Lab-grown diamonds are, from a chemical perspective, as much real diamonds as natural diamonds. Carbon atoms in a Diamond Cubic crystallographic structure. It's quite common these days and affordable to make them in the lab. The natural diamond industry is pretty dirty, with prices artificially controlled by the De Beers company.
